iPadOS 16 reportedly delayed from September to October

iPadOS 16

Apple will delay the launch from September to October, reports Bloomberg. Among other reasons, the tech giant plans to stagger iPhone and iPad operating system updates.

Another reason for the iPadOS 16‌ delay is purportedly because Apple is still working out the kinds of Stage Manager. The feature, available only for M.x processor equipped iPads brings a new way to multitask with multiple overlapping windows.

The Sellers Research Group (that’s me) thinks Bloomberg is correct regarding the delay. October is likely also the month when we’ll see new iPads and iPad Pros debut.

Bloomberg says watchOS 9 will still arrive in September as anticipated, likely along with new Apple Watches. However, the roll out of macOS Ventura, which also implements the Stage Manager feature may also be pushed back past September, per Bloomberg.
